Haunted Loop House by smiley405

[raw]
made by smiley405 for Ludum Dare 47 (JAM)

This is a game-jam entry for Ludum Dare 47.

Play as an Old Papa, Explore the haunted house.

Warning.. only the brave ones can survive!

controls: [W, A, S and D to move ]

Format: Browser game

Tools used: PIXI.js[hexi-modded], tiled map editor & gimp
